Original Description
Henry William Brewer's Interior of the Cathedral of Bois-le-duc is a captivating 19th-century architectural watercolor that immerses viewers in the serene grandeur of Gothic spirituality. The painting meticulously captures St. John's Cathedral in 's-Hertogenbosch (Bois-le-duc), Netherlands, with its soaring vaulted ceilings and intricate stone tracery bathed in ethereal light filtering through stained glass. Brewer, known for his topographical precision and romanticized interpretation of medieval architecture, renders the sacred space with a photorealistic yet poetic sensibility. The artwork stands as an important example of Victorian Gothic Revival documentation, bridging archaeological accuracy with atmospheric storytelling. Soft washes of color convey the weight of centuries-old stone, while delicate penwork highlights the cathedral's elaborate ribbed vaulting—a testament to Brewer's dual mastery of draughtsmanship and watercolor techniques that made him a sought-after illustrator for ecclesiastical publications.
